Polishing Briar Pipes
Polishing briar pipes is an important practice to maintain the beauty and durability of these smoking instruments. Briar, being a natural material, can benefit from regular polishing to preserve its shine and protect it from wear and tear. Typically, specific products for polishing briar pipes are used, such as dedicated creams or oils. Before proceeding with the polishing, it is advisable to thoroughly clean the surface of the pipe to remove smoke residues and dirt. With proper polishing, a briar pipe can retain its splendor and elegance over time.
Best Briar Pipe Wax
The best wax for briar pipes is the one made of natural beeswax. This type of wax is ideal for protecting and maintaining the briar of the pipe in excellent condition over time. Beeswax forms a protective layer that helps prevent damage caused by moisture and daily wear. Moreover, beeswax gives a beautiful shiny finish to the surface of the pipe, enhancing its natural beauty. Make sure to apply the wax gently and regularly to preserve your briar pipe in the best possible way.
Cleaning Techniques for Briar Pipes
Cleaning briar pipes is essential to ensure proper functionality and maintain the quality of the smoke. Here are some recommended techniques:- After each use, empty the ash and run a pipe cleaner through the stem and the bowl.- Once a day, clean the bowl with a specific pipe reamer.- Occasionally, remove the filter and clean or replace it if necessary.- If the briar pipe becomes too hot, let it cool down before using it again.- Avoid overheating the pipe excessively to preserve the briar over time.By following these simple practices, you can enjoy your briar pipe for a long time.
How to keep a briar pipe shiny
To keep a briar pipe shiny, it is important to follow some fundamental steps:1. Regular cleaning: After each use, remove any residues of burnt tobacco and dampen a piece of cotton with alcohol to clean the inside of the pipe.2. Polishing: Use a soft cloth to gently rub the outside of the pipe with beeswax or vaseline oil to maintain its shine.3. Avoid residue buildup: Smoke in moderation and regularly empty the pipe bowl to prevent the accumulation of burnt tobacco residues.By following these simple tips, it will be possible to keep your briar pipe shiny and in excellent condition over time.
